Storm Damage Repair
Niles’s postwar ranches and raised-ranches, built with 4-in-12 or lower pitches, are uniquely vulnerable to ice dam damage because their minimal attic ventilation and original soffits trap heat, accelerating freeze-thaw failures that are less severe in lakeshore communities like Evanston. When a February thaw hits after a hard freeze, water backs up behind ice ridges and seeps into fascia, soffits, and interior walls. Our storm damage repair in Niles addresses both the visible leak and the underlying ventilation failure. We replace saturated decking, install proper ice-and-water shield, and specify wider drip edge profiles that stand up to Cook County’s repeated freeze-thaw cycles. Standard drip edge on a 4-in-12 roof lifts and leaks here. We do not install it.

Wind Damage
Summer storms tracking northeast across the Chicago metro drive straight into Niles with little lake buffering. Wind lifts shingles on 50-to-70-year-old roofs that have lost sealant adhesion. We inspect for lifted tabs, creased shingles, and displaced ridge caps, then determine whether targeted repair or full replacement makes sense. On Niles’s aging asphalt shingles, we often find hail damage that pre-weakened the field, making wind failure more extensive than it first appears. Our inspection tells you what you are actually dealing with.

Common Emergency & Storm Damage Problems We See in Niles Homes
- Unpermitted tear-offs: Starting work without a Niles building permit risks a stop-work order, leaving your home exposed to further storm damage. We file permits before the first shingle comes off.
- Improper ice dam mitigation on low-slope ranches: Without addressing poor attic ventilation and insufficient underlayment, ice dams recur and worsen. Emergency repair that only patches the leak wastes your money.
- Using standard drip edge on 4-in-12 roofs: In Niles’s freeze-thaw cycles, this lifts and leaks. A wider profile and proper flashing are essential, and we install them as standard practice.
- Brittle asphalt shingles on 1960s-70s homes: Niles’s aging shingles have lost flexibility. Hail that would bounce off newer roofs cracks and fractures these, creating hidden damage that leaks months later.
Pricing for Emergency & Storm Damage in Niles, IL
Here is what emergency and storm damage work costs in Niles’s market. These are actual ranges for typical jobs we complete in the 60714 area:
- Emergency tarping (single breach, standard access): $275-$450
- Storm damage repair (localized wind/hail damage, 1-2 squares): $650-$1,400
- Ice dam remediation with ventilation correction (typical ranch): $1,800-$3,200
- Tree damage repair (limb removal, decking replacement, 2-4 squares): $2,400-$4,800
- Full storm-damage tear-off and replacement (1,200 sq ft ranch, GAF or CertainTeed): $9,500-$14,500
- Insurance claim coordination and documentation: included with repair or replacement
What moves the number: roof pitch (lower pitches take longer), accessibility (tight Niles lots require hand-carrying materials), decking condition (water-damaged plywood adds material and labor), and whether permit corrections are needed for prior unpermitted work.
